May 29th According to Sky Sports, Atlanta hopes to coach Sarri, but Lazio leads the competition.
Atlanta current coach Gasperini is approaching to leave the team and may go to Rome to coach. So Atlanta needs to find a new coach and take a fancy to Coach Surrey. However, since Gasperini's departure will take some time, Atlanta has not yet provided a formal offer to Surrey.
Sky Sports Italy revealed that Lazio has offered Sarri a two-year contract with an annual salary of 2.8 million euros, hoping to invite him to coach. Lazio is currently leading Atlanta in Surrey’s competition.
